WordNet (r) 3.0 (2006):
St. Thomas
    n 1: the Apostle who would not believe the resurrection of Jesus
         until he saw Jesus with his own eyes [syn: Thomas, Saint
         Thomas, St. Thomas, doubting Thomas, Thomas the
         doubting Apostle]
    2: (Roman Catholic Church) Italian theologian and Doctor of the
       Church who is remembered for his attempt to reconcile faith
       and reason in a comprehensive theology; presented
       philosophical proofs of the existence of God (1225-1274)
       [syn: Aquinas, Thomas Aquinas, Saint Thomas, St.
       Thomas, Saint Thomas Aquinas, St. Thomas Aquinas]
